New Support Group
The West Island Crisis Center is offering a new support group focused on motivation and goal setting. Participants will have the opportunity to explore different types of motivation, learn how to set realistic goals (including SMART goals), and discuss concepts such as self-compassion, kindness, and self-esteem. Empowering Newcomer Families Together
Empowering Newcomer Families Together: An AMCAL Family Services and the West Island Community Resource Center (CRC) collaboration created to help guide newly arrived families to Quebec living in the West Island to resources and services they may need.
